
The Weeknd links up with Future on "Double Fantasy"
The Weeknd shares his collaboration with Future.
“Double Fantasy” featuring Future is the first original song off The Weeknd’s upcoming HBO Original series The Idol and includes production from himself along with Mike Dean and additional co-production from Metro Boomin. The Weeknd performed the song for the first time during Metro Boomin's Coachella set.
The new series is co-created by Sam Levinson (HBO’s “Euphoria”), Abel “The Weeknd” Tesfaye and Reza Fahim, and stars Abel Tesfaye and Lily-Rose Depp. The Idol will premiere at this year’s annual Festival De Cannes in France.
The series will air on HBO and be available to stream on Max.
The song marks The Weeknd and Future’s fifth collaboration after the two first came together as featured artists on producer Mike WiLL Made-It‘s 2015 single “Drinks on Us,” which also featured Swae Lee. They've also linked up on “All I Know” from The Weeknd's Starboy LP, and “Comin Out Strong” on Future’s album HNDRXX.
“Double Fantasy” featuring Future is out now on XO Records/Republic Records. The Idol will be debuted on 4 June.
